The mass of a degenerate equilibrium star is determined within the framework of the approximate energetic method. The given parameters are the density of matter in the center of the star and discrete values of the intensity of the magnetic field frozen into the stellar interior; the field quantizes for the degenerate ultrarelativistic electron gas. It is shown that for certain values of the mass of the magnetized degenerate equilibrium star, the condition for the star's stability is fulfilled.
